Saving lives - today and tomorrow

Did you know that efforts to curtail climate change - like reducing gre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by switching to renewable energy rather than fossil fuels - will not only save lives in the future but improve things for the world’s people today? For example, as we use less fossil fuels, “we also reduce the deadly air pollution that contributes to nearly 7 million deaths each year worldwide – more than war, terrorism, malaria, HIV, and alcohol and drug use combined.”
